+#include "SubsystemObject.h"
+#include "Subsystem.h"
+#include "InstanceConfigurableElement.h"
+#include "ParameterBlackboard.h"
+#include "ParameterAccessContext.h"
+#include "MappingContext.h"
+#include "ParameterType.h"
+#include "convert.hpp"
+#include <assert.h>
+#include <stdlib.h>
+#include <string.h>
+#include <sstream>
+#include <stdarg.h>
+
+using std::string;
+
+CSubsystemObject::CSubsystemObject(CInstanceConfigurableElement *pInstanceConfigurableElement,
+ core::log::Logger &logger)
+ : _logger(logger), _pInstanceConfigurableElement(pInstanceConfigurableElement),
+ _dataSize(pInstanceConfigurableElement->getFootPrint())
+{
+ // Syncer
+ _pInstanceConfigurableElement->setSyncer(this);
+}
+
+CSubsystemObject::~CSubsystemObject()
+{
+ _pInstanceConfigurableElement->unsetSyncer();
+}
+
+string CSubsystemObject::getFormattedMappingValue() const
+{
+ // Default formatted mapping value is empty
+ return "";
+}
+
+// Blackboard data location
+uint8_t *CSubsystemObject::getBlackboardLocation() const
+{
+ return _blackboard->getLocation(getOffset());
+}
+
+// Size
+size_t CSubsystemObject::getSize() const
+{
+ return _dataSize;
+}
+
+int CSubsystemObject::toPlainInteger(
+ const CInstanceConfigurableElement *instanceConfigurableElement, int sizeOptimizedData)
+{
+ if (instanceConfigurableElement) {
+
+ // Get actual element type
+ const CTypeElement *typeElement =
+ static_cast<const CParameterType *>(instanceConfigurableElement->getTypeElement());
+
+ // Do the extension
+ return typeElement->toPlainInteger(sizeOptimizedData);
+ }
+
+ return sizeOptimizedData;
+}
+
+// Default back synchronization
+void CSubsystemObject::setDefaultValues(CParameterBlackboard &parameterBlackboard) const
+{
+ string strError;
+
+ // Create access context
+ CParameterAccessContext parameterAccessContext(strError, &parameterBlackboard);
+
+ // Just implement back synchronization with default values
+ _pInstanceConfigurableElement->setDefaultValues(parameterAccessContext);
+}
+
+// Synchronization
+bool CSubsystemObject::sync(CParameterBlackboard &parameterBlackboard, bool bBack, string &strError)
+{
+ // Get blackboard location
+ _blackboard = &parameterBlackboard;
+ // Access index init
+ _accessedIndex = 0;
+
+#ifdef SIMULATION
+ return true;
+#endif
+
+ // Retrieve subsystem
+ const CSubsystem *pSubsystem = _pInstanceConfigurableElement->getBelongingSubsystem();
+
+ // Get it's health insdicator
+ bool bIsSubsystemAlive = pSubsystem->isAlive();
+
+ // Check subsystem health
+ if (!bIsSubsystemAlive) {
+
+ strError = "Susbsystem not alive";
+ }
+
+ // Synchronize to/from HW
+ if (!bIsSubsystemAlive || !accessHW(bBack, strError)) {
+
+ // Fall back to parameter default initialization
+ if (bBack) {
+
+ setDefaultValues(parameterBlackboard);
+ }
+ return false;
+ }
+
+ return true;
+}
+
+// Sync to/from HW
+bool CSubsystemObject::sendToHW(string &strError)
+{
+ strError = "Send to HW interface not implemented at subsystem level";
+
+ return false;
+}
+
+bool CSubsystemObject::receiveFromHW(string & /*strError*/)
+{
+ // Back synchronization is not supported at subsystem level.
+ // Rely on blackboard content
+
+ return true;
+}
+
+// Fall back HW access
+bool CSubsystemObject::accessHW(bool bReceive, string &strError)
+{
+ // Default access fall back
+ if (bReceive) {
+
+ return receiveFromHW(strError);
+ } else {
+
+ return sendToHW(strError);
+ }
+}
+
+// Blackboard access from subsystems
+void CSubsystemObject::blackboardRead(void *pvData, size_t size)
+{
+ _blackboard->readBuffer(pvData, size, getOffset() + _accessedIndex);
+
+ _accessedIndex += size;
+}
+
+void CSubsystemObject::blackboardWrite(const void *pvData, size_t size)
+{
+ _blackboard->writeBuffer(pvData, size, getOffset() + _accessedIndex);
+
+ _accessedIndex += size;
+}
+
+// Configurable element retrieval
+const CInstanceConfigurableElement *CSubsystemObject::getConfigurableElement() const
+{
+ return _pInstanceConfigurableElement;
+}
+// Belonging Subsystem retrieval
+const CSubsystem *CSubsystemObject::getSubsystem() const
+{
+ return _pInstanceConfigurableElement->getBelongingSubsystem();
+}
+
+size_t CSubsystemObject::getOffset() const
+{
+ return _pInstanceConfigurableElement->getOffset();
+}
